Double standard?


I hope David Reinhard can now match his ideals to what he puts on paper. His last opinion page was exactly the double standard that I have seen in the folks who follow his opinions. I would like to zero in on the statement in his column; "Folks who think that individuals cannot be trusted to protect their own interests or make the best decision for themselves and their world will always find plausible, if attenuated, excuses to turn a traditionally private matter into a public cause celebre."

The point is a good one and one that I have often stated while discussing abortion. If he truly believes what he wrote then let us give women the freedom to do what they want with their bodies. To me it is the most personal matter and is in no way the responsibility of the government to tell women what they can or cannot do with their bodies. Thank you so much Mr. Reinhard for helping me to make my point.
